DPS announces temporary waiver for driver licenses, ID cards ending April 2021

The Texas Department of Public Safety announced that the waiver on expiration dates for driver licenses and identification cards ends on April 14, 2021. Customers who need to renew are urged to make an appointment.

The waiver, granted by Governor Greg Abbott in March due to the COVID-19 pandemic, applied to DLs, commercial DLs, commercial learner permits, ID cards and election identification certificates that expired on or after March 13, 2020.

Expanded office hours

Designated DPS offices are offering expanded hours from 7 a.m. to 7 p.m. Monday through Thursday, and 7 a.m. to 5:30 p.m. on Friday, starting on Jan. 4. Appointments are already being accepted for the additional hours. The participating offices were selected based on the volume of customer transactions.

In addition, this Saturday, Dec. 19, is the last day for Saturday appointments, which are still available at many locations across the state.

You can also renew your DL/ID card or changing their address online at Texas.gov. Customers can also renew by phone at 1-866-357-3639 (1-866-DL-RENEW). The requirements and cost for online and phone renewal are the same as in-person transactions.
